The ice cream song

“Kwality! Kwality!” is what the ice cream man would cry as he wheeled his cart through the lanes and by-lanes of Kolkata in the 1980s and 1990s. He was relaxed as he made this beckoning call. He knew that in the late afternoon and early evening, kids and adults of upper-middle-class households would be in an unhurried state of mind to buy ice cream to further unwind.

Sometimes we’d ask him to halt by the time he had almost disappeared down the wind of the street. He had a sharp hearing, so he’d return most of the time with a smile on his perspired face asking, “How many kids live here? How many ice creams of which flavours do you want?”

My widowed mother could only afford vanilla. “That’s the best and healthiest flavour,” she reasoned.

Sometimes the ice cream seller would vanish by the street bend before we could stop him. He was exploring the maze of tiny winding streets of the city till twilight set in and TV sets beamed with the first evening news.

On scorching hot summer afternoons, he’d traverse the streets in silence, wiping the sweat off his brow. The ice creams had sold like hotcakes or had melted despite the icebox within.

In India, sweet sellers would travel villages, cities and towns on foot pleasantly hawking their wares. There’s a heart-wrenching scene in Satyajit Ray’s Pather Panchali where impoverished Apu and Durga are prohibited by their mother to buy sweets. They find joy in simply following the sweetmeat seller with a dog at their heels through the village woods.

In our neighbourhood, the mother of a poor man was on her deathbed after a long and painful illness. The doctor said that she simply had a night to live. Her last wish was, “I want to eat a lot of ice cream along with my family.” That day the entire collection of ice cream was bought from a trolley. She breathed her last at dawn.
